Strategies for adversarially training deep learning models to improve worst case performance under attacks.
This evergreen guide examines robust adversarial strategies that strengthen deep learning systems against hostile perturbations, covering training dynamics, evaluation protocols, theoretical insights, and practical deployment considerations for sustained resilience.
Published August 02, 2025
Facebook X Reddit Pinterest Email
Adversarial training has emerged as a central technique for hardening neural networks against hostile inputs that aim to mislead them. The core idea is to expose the model to carefully crafted perturbations during training so that it learns to maintain accurate predictions despite interference. Effective adversarial training requires a careful balance between realism and efficiency: perturbations should be representative of real-world attack vectors while remaining computationally tractable to generate within standard training cycles. Researchers have proposed diverse strategies, from simple norm-bounded attacks to more complex, data-dependent perturbations, all aimed at shaping a decision boundary that resists malicious manipulations. Implementations must also consider hardware constraints and dataset scales to maintain practical throughput.
Beyond merely consuming more compute, robust training hinges on thoughtful optimization and evaluation practices. A key element is the schedule used to introduce adversarial examples, which can significantly influence convergence speed and model resilience. Techniques such as curriculum adversarial training gradually increase perturbation strength, allowing the model to adapt incrementally to tougher examples. Regularization methods tied to robustness, including entropy penalties and margin-based objectives, help prevent overfitting to a single attack pattern. Crucially, evaluation should move past average-case metrics and include worst-case performance tests, simulating prolonged adversarial campaigns to reveal latent weaknesses. Consistent benchmarking ensures progress remains tangible across evolving threat models.
Robustness strategies balance exploration, regularization, and realism in perturbations.
The data strategy for adversarial robustness starts with clean, well-curated inputs and deliberate augmentation that reveals model blind spots. Curated datasets should capture a spectrum of plausible threats while preserving essential semantic content. Augmentations inspired by real-world scenarios—sparse occlusions, lighting changes, pixel-level jitter—force the model to rely on stable, high-level features rather than brittle cues. Additionally, splitting data into robust training, validation, and holdout sets helps validate that improvements extend beyond specific attack configurations. It is equally important to incorporate domain-specific constraints so the adversarial perturbations remain plausible within the intended application. A rigorous data protocol underpins reliable and repeatable robustness gains.
ADVERTISEMENT
ADVERTISEMENT
In practice, adversarial training pairs each clean example with a perturbed counterpart, then trains the model to agree on both. This dynamic often requires solving a nested optimization problem: selecting a perturbation that maximally disrupts the prediction within a permitted budget, while updating model parameters to minimize loss on these adversarial examples. Efficient solvers, such as projected gradient methods and their variants, enable feasible training times. The choice of perturbation norm (for example, L2, L-infinity, or a perceptual metric) shapes the nature of robustness achieved. Researchers must also monitor potential trade-offs, including possible reductions in clean accuracy, and adjust training objectives to preserve overall performance integrity.
Curriculum-aware strategies improve robustness through staged challenge.
Regularization is a cornerstone of robust learning, guiding the model toward stable representations under stress. Techniques like mixed-precision training can introduce micro-noise that unexpectedly strengthens generalization, while spectral normalization constrains the capacity of layers to overfit to adversarial cues. Additionally, Jacobian regularization, which penalizes sensitivity of the output to small input changes, nudges the network toward flatter, more reliable decision boundaries. Adversarial training benefits from diverse perturbations during optimization, encouraging the model to rely on robust features rather than fragile textures. As a result, resilience grows not just against a single threat, but across a constellation of potential attacks.
ADVERTISEMENT
ADVERTISEMENT
Another practical lever is curriculum design for perturbations, where complexity rises with training progress. Early phases expose the model to mild distortions, building foundational robustness without overwhelming learning signals. Later stages introduce stronger perturbations that mimic real-world adversaries, reinforcing the habits learned earlier. This gradual escalation helps prevent optimization from stalling or diverging. It also aligns with human learning trajectories, where mastery emerges through paced exposure. When combined with robust validation, curricula can produce models that perform reliably in environments with unpredictable interference.
Thorough evaluation reveals gaps and directs targeted improvements.
A building block of robust systems is resilient evaluation that mirrors the unpredictability of deployment. Performance should be assessed under a spectrum of attacks, including adaptive strategies that tailor perturbations to the current model state. This approach uncovers weaknesses that static testing might overlook. Evaluation should include not only targeted accuracy but also calibration, confidence estimation, and failure modes analysis under adversarial conditions. By tracking robust metrics across multiple threat classes, teams can identify which components contribute most to resilience and where additional defenses are warranted. Transparent reporting of evaluation procedures fosters trust and comparability across studies.
When measuring worst-case performance, one must recognize that robustness is not binary. A model can resist certain perturbations effectively while remaining vulnerable to others, especially under adaptive attacks that exploit newly discovered gaps. Therefore, a comprehensive testing suite is essential, combining benign data, well-chosen adversarial samples, and stress tests that push the model to its limits. Visualization tools can help practitioners see how decision boundaries shift in response to perturbations, revealing systematic biases or brittle regions. By interpreting these diagnostics, developers can guide targeted improvements and iterate more intelligently.
ADVERTISEMENT
ADVERTISEMENT
Continuous monitoring and cross-disciplinary collaboration sustain resilience.
Implementation considerations play a decisive role in bringing adversarial robustness from theory to practice. Computational overhead is a common obstacle, as generating adversarial perturbations on the fly can slow training dramatically. Solutions include caching frequently used perturbations, leveraging mixed-precision arithmetic, and distributing computations across hardware accelerators. Software engineering practices—modular architectures, clear interfaces, and reproducible environments—reduce friction when integrating adversarial training into existing pipelines. It is also essential to monitor resource usage, such as memory and energy consumption, to ensure robustness efforts remain affordable at scale. Smooth deployment depends on predictable, maintainable infrastructure.
Deployment-ready robustness demands thoughtful integration with model maintenance workflows. As models receive updates, their adversarial vulnerabilities can shift, making continuous robustness monitoring vital. Versioned evaluation dashboards, automated retraining triggers, and anomaly detection on production predictions help maintain resilience over time. Organizations should establish risk-based thresholds that determine when a model requires additional adversarial training or defensive augmentation. Collaboration across data science, security, and operations teams strengthens the approach, ensuring that defensive measures align with business objectives and regulatory expectations. Ultimately, robust systems endure changes in threat landscapes without collapsing under pressure.
Theoretical underpinnings provide a compass for practical defense design. Generalization bounds, domain adaptation theories, and robust optimization frameworks illuminate why certain strategies work and under what conditions they might fail. While proofs cannot capture every real-world nuance, they offer valuable intuition about the geometry of decision boundaries and the role of perturbations. Bridging theory with practice involves translating abstract guarantees into concrete training recipes, evaluation protocols, and diagnostic metrics. This synthesis helps teams avoid common pitfalls, such as over-tuning to a narrow attack family or misinterpreting robustness gains as universal protection. A grounded theoretical perspective complements empirical effort, guiding long-term strategy.
The payoff of investing in adversarial robustness is enduring reliability. Models armed with principled training regimens, comprehensive evaluation, and rigorous deployment practices tend to retain performance under diverse disturbance regimes. The resulting systems are better suited for high-stakes settings where misclassifications carry substantial risk. While no defense is eternal, a disciplined approach—rooted in data quality, optimization discipline, and transparent assessment—anchors resilience as a core capability. As attackers evolve, defenders who adopt robust training as a foundational practice will be better positioned to anticipate, adapt, and endure.
Related Articles
Deep learning
Cross-domain regularization techniques empower deep learning models to generalize across diverse domains, reducing distribution shifts, encouraging robust feature alignment, and enabling more reliable transfer of learned representations to new tasks and environments.
-
July 27, 2025
Deep learning
Understand how to quantify the marginal benefit of extra labeled data, the risks of overfitting annotation budgets, and practical methods for guiding investment decisions in real-world machine learning projects.
-
July 29, 2025
Deep learning
This evergreen guide surveys practical strategies to reduce memory footprints in training deep networks, enabling researchers and engineers to harness constrained hardware efficiently while preserving model performance and training speed.
-
August 12, 2025
Deep learning
This evergreen guide explores practical strategies for aligning text and image representations through contrastive learning, enabling robust multimodal models that understand descriptions and visuals cohesively, while avoiding domain pitfalls and misalignment risks.
-
July 18, 2025
Deep learning
This evergreen exploration reveals how reinforcement learning concepts harmonize with deep learning, enabling robust decision making amid uncertainty by blending value estimation, policy optimization, and scalable representation learning.
-
August 09, 2025
Deep learning
Versioning data and tracing lineage are foundational for reproducible deep learning, enabling researchers to audit experiments, compare results, and maintain trust across evolving datasets and models with scalable, robust practices.
-
July 26, 2025
Deep learning
This evergreen guide explores how parameter efficient tuning and adapter-based techniques can work in harmony, enabling precise specialization of expansive neural networks while preserving computational resources and scalability across diverse tasks and domains.
-
July 21, 2025
Deep learning
Meta learning offers principled pathways for rapid adaptation, enabling models to transfer knowledge across diverse tasks with minimal data. This evergreen guide examines core strategies, practical considerations, and future directions for practitioners exploring fast domain shift adaptation and robust transfer.
-
August 12, 2025
Deep learning
When combining symbolic logic constraints with differentiable learning, researchers explore hybrid representations, constraint-guided optimization, and differentiable logic approximations to create systems that reason precisely and learn robustly from data.
-
July 15, 2025
Deep learning
Adaptive data augmentation tailors transformations to target model weaknesses, using feedback-driven strategies, curriculum learning, and domain-aware perturbations to strengthen underperforming regions while preserving overall performance.
-
August 02, 2025
Deep learning
Differentiable rendering bridges physics-based modeling and learning, enabling networks to reason about light, materials, and geometry. This evergreen overview explores practical strategies, architectural choices, datasets, and evaluation techniques that sustain progress in 3D scene understanding.
-
July 19, 2025
Deep learning
This evergreen guide explores robust techniques to maximize learning from limited labels by leveraging intrinsic data structure, domain insights, and cross-task signals, reducing annotation burdens while preserving model performance over time.
-
July 26, 2025
Deep learning
Building robust deep learning systems requires structured failure mode catalogs that translate real-world risks into testable scenarios, enabling proactive hardening, targeted validation, and iterative improvement across model lifecycles.
-
August 12, 2025
Deep learning
This evergreen piece surveys practical strategies for uncovering spurious correlations in deep learning, explaining measurement techniques, diagnostic workflows, and remediation methods that preserve genuine signals while preventing misleading model behavior.
-
July 18, 2025
Deep learning
In real-world AI deployments, pretrained models encounter data forms different from their training modality, prompting transfer learning strategies that bridge modality gaps, preserve learned representations, and exploit cross-domain signals for robust adaptation.
-
August 12, 2025
Deep learning
This evergreen guide examines practical feedback loop designs that harness user corrections to improve deep learning systems, focusing on data collection, modeling choices, evaluation stability, and governance for continuous refinement.
-
July 29, 2025
Deep learning
A practical, evergreen guide exploring principled methods to tune ensemble diversity, balancing model differences, data views, training regimes, and evaluation signals to achieve robust, complementary performance across tasks.
-
August 03, 2025
Deep learning
Across diverse industries, measuring long term social impacts of deep learning requires robust, multi dimensional frameworks that blend quantitative indicators with qualitative insights, adaptive benchmarks, and continuous learning to capture emergent effects on labor, equity, governance, safety, and cultural change over time.
-
August 06, 2025
Deep learning
Designing dependable confidence intervals for deep learning predictions requires careful statistical treatment, thoughtful calibration, and practical validation across diverse datasets, tasks, and deployment environments to ensure trustworthy uncertainty estimates.
-
August 08, 2025
Deep learning
Modular transformer design patterns empower researchers to plug, swap, and optimize components, enabling scalable experimentation, rapid prototyping, cross-domain transfer, and resilient performance across vision, language, and multimodal tasks.
-
July 19, 2025